Baldness

Baldness is a condition, a disease in which a person experiences excessive hair loss from his scalp. Everyone wants to look beautiful and a good and healthy hair makes someone very handsome and beautiful. baldness not only disturbs the person mentally, but it leads to poor health as well, as the bald person could think nothing except how to regain his black, shinny, long, hair. There are several effective and easily available home remedies for the treatment of baldness. However, there is no permanent cure. This article will explain in lengths about the symptoms, cause and home remedies for the treatment of baldness.

Baldness Causes

baldness not only is a disturbing disease, but it also embarrasses the person. It is very true that a bald person tries all his best to do whatever is suggested by friend, family, dear and dear ones for getting back his lost hair. The main causes of baldness are: prolong illness, jaundice, bacterial attack on the scalp, excess intake of vitamins, hormonal and genetics disorder, lack of estrogen level because of poor functioning of thyroid glands. Age is another major reason for baldness or extensive hair loss. Other reasons, especially in women, are irregular periods, post-pregnancy effect, etc.

Home Remedies for Baldness - Baldness Treatment

baldness is caused due to the lack of estrogen in human body. There are various treatments available to regain the level of estrogen in the human body. A bald person looses his confidence and feels embarrassed in facing family, friends, etc. However, they should not forget that life never stops here, baldness is a normal disease and they should not feel bad about it.

Curd:

Curd with camphor plays an important role in improving the growth of hair over the bald scalp. Take curd and camphor, both in equal quantity (3-5 tablespoon). Mix it well and keep it aside for some time. Apply this paste over the effected scalp, and let it dry for three-four hours. Clean the scalp with warm water This is one of the useful home remedies for baldness.

Honey:

Honey also plays a vital role in the treatment of baldness. Mix honey and egg yolk and cover the entire effected scalp with it. Allow it to stand for 1-2 hours and wash the scalp. Similarly, onion juice and honey can be mixed together and applied to the effected area. This too will show positive result.

Other way of using honey for hair growth is mix 2 tablespoon of honey with 1 tablespoon of cinnamon powder and 2-3 tablespoons of olive oil. Mix this paste and apply it over the effected area. Allow it to stand for 20 minutes and then wash it off. This is one of the best home remedies for baldness.

Lemon:

Lemon too is another easiest home remedy for the treatment of baldness. Take a lemon and cut it into two pieces, and rub it over the effected area. Do this regularly for 2-3 months. This will give positive result. Similarly, lemon seeds can also be dried and powdered along with black pepper. Mix this powder in sufficient amount of water and apply over the bald scalp. Wash it off after some time.

Massage:

Massaging scalp helps in blood circulation. Sometimes after a long day work, or due to prolong illness, baldness, etc., the blood circulation does not flow in its natural flow. Simply massaging with hands in a circular way is also very important in bringing back the blood flow to its normal. There are home made hair oils, paste that helps in the growth of hair over the bald scalp. Most of these oils and herbs can be used 3-4 times a week.

The easiest one is massaging with coconut milk. Apply coconut milk over the entire scalp and allow it to stand for a half to one hour. Wash the scalp with warm water.

Another massage oil is almond oil. Just apply it over the scalp area and massage gently for at least 2 times a week. Almond oil can also be mixed with castor oil. This is one of the important home remedies for baldness.

Massage oil extracted from dry mango works great over the bald scalp. Take mango pulp and mix in mustard or coconut oil. Allow it to stand for months, until the mango extract is completely mixed in oil. Apply this over the bald scalp, and massage thoroughly and gently. This will show results after 1-2 month.

Amla:

Goose berry or amla plays vital role for the growth of hair on the bald scalp. Person suffering from baldness may apply a mixture prepared by boiling 200 grams of goose berry, shikakai and soapnuts or reetha in 2-3 liter of water. Boil the mixture until it water reduces to half. Allow it to stand and apply it over hair. Let the mixture dry over the scalp for around 3 hours and wash it off with warm water. This shampoo can be used for 2-3 months. It will show tremendous growth of hair. Amla powder can also be mixed with egg and fenugreek seeds, and treated as a shampoo for hair. This too is an effective remedy for shinny hair.

Fenugreek seeds:

Soak 12-15 fenugreek seeds in 1 liter of water overnight. Preserve the extracted oil and apply it gently over the scalp. This oil can be used 1-2 times a day. This will show a great result in hair growth after 1-2 months.One of the useful home remedies for baldness.

Diet:

A balanced diet is a must for the healthy growth and development of a human body. Person suffering from baldness should take diet rich in protein, green vegetables, cereals, fruits like mango, carrots, milk products like milk, curd, etc. One can also take juice prepared from banana and honey and curd. Another juice is alfalfa or simsim mixed with fresh green coriander leaves. All this will help regaining hair over the bald scalp.
